Olympic Council Of Ireland Reveals Costs Of Rio Ticketing Controversy

The "fall out from the arrest" of former Olympic Council of Ireland President Pat Hickey has cost the OCI €628,000 ($667,300) to date, the "embattled" organization's extraordinary general meeting heard, according to Shane Phelan of the IRISH INDEPENDENT. The meeting, at Dublin's Conrad Hotel, also heard tributes being paid to Hickey, who is facing "ticket touting charges in Brazil." Delegates from 36 sporting federations met Thursday to elect Swim Ireland CEO Sarah Keane as Hickey's successor, the first new OCI president in 28 years. Treasurer Billy Kennedy said that law firm Arthur Cox had been paid €394,000 ($418,700) for "legal advice in the wake of the controversy over his arrest." Consultants Grant Thornton have been paid €214,900 ($228,400), while a report on "corporate governance" from Deloitte cost €18,500 ($19,700). Public relations costs "stemming from the OCI’s use of The Communications Clinic" amounted to €69,500 ($73,900) (IRISH INDEPENDENT, 2/9).
